Common Issues and Errors Related to Grd_enu.dll
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:
- The file Grd_enu.dll is missing: This suggests that a DLL file required for certain functionalities is not available in your system. This could have occurred due to manual deletion, system restore, or a recent software uninstallation.
- Grd_enu.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message implies that there could be an error within the DLL file, or the DLL is not compatible with the Windows version you're running. This could occur if there's a mismatch between the DLL file and the Windows version or system architecture.
- Grd_enu.dll Access Violation: The error signifies that an operation attempted to access a protected portion of memory associated with the Grd_enu.dll. This could happen due to improper coding, software incompatibilities, or memory-related issues.
- Grd_enu.dll not found: The system failed to locate the necessary DLL file for execution. The file might have been deleted or misplaced.
- This application failed to start because Grd_enu.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.

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the Grd_enu.dll Errors
In this guide, we will aim to resolve issues related to Grd_enu.dll by utilizing the (DISM) tool.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Command Prompt
in the search bar. -
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.
-
In the Command Prompt window, type
D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th
and press Enter. -
Allow the Deployment Image Servicing and Management tool to scan your system and correct any errors it detects.
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ool
How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test. If the Grd_enu.dll error is related to memory issues it should resolve the problem.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Windows Memory Diagnostic
in the search bar and press Enter.
-
In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).
-
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.
-
After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.
